Output 63f6658933d5192e8bcd7556531ecc1440450b4ca6a86712bab82801418aa143:147

value
42664
script pubkey
OP_0 OP_PUSHBYTES_20 cc7c3ad2ab3141cc01baff78f6e6020d4777314f
address
bc1qe37r454tx9qucqd6lau0deszp4rhwv20tl63mj
transaction
63f6658933d5192e8bcd7556531ecc1440450b4ca6a86712bab82801418aa143
spent
true